First off, let's talk about what U shaped rubber strips are. These strips are exactly what they sound like - rubber strips shaped like the letter "U". They come in different materials, sizes, and hardness levels, which makes them quite versatile. We've got options like silicone, neoprene, and EPDM, each with its own set of properties.

Now, when it comes to elevator applications, there are several areas where U shaped rubber strips can be super useful. One of the main uses is for sealing. Elevators need to be well - sealed to keep out dust, dirt, and even water in some cases. The U shape of the rubber strip allows it to fit snugly around different parts of the elevator, creating an effective barrier. For example, it can be used around the elevator doors. When the doors close, the U shaped rubber strip can prevent air and debris from getting into the elevator car. This not only improves the comfort of the passengers but also helps to protect the internal components of the elevator from damage.

Another important application is for noise reduction. Elevators can be noisy, especially when the doors open and close or when the elevator is moving up and down. U shaped rubber strips can act as a buffer between different parts of the elevator, absorbing vibrations and reducing the amount of noise that is transmitted. For instance, if there are metal parts that come into contact with each other during the operation of the elevator, placing a U shaped rubber strip between them can significantly cut down on the clanging and rattling sounds.

In terms of safety, U shaped rubber strips can also play a role. They can be used to provide a soft edge around sharp corners or edges inside the elevator. This helps to prevent passengers from getting injured if they accidentally bump into these areas. Additionally, in the case of emergency stops or sudden movements, the rubber strips can absorb some of the impact, reducing the risk of damage to the elevator and potential harm to the passengers.

Let's take a closer look at the materials. Silicone U shaped rubber strips are a popular choice for elevator applications. Silicone is known for its excellent temperature resistance, which means it can perform well in both hot and cold environments. Neoprene U shaped rubber strips are another option. Neoprene is resistant to oil, chemicals, and weathering. This makes it a great choice for elevators that are exposed to harsh conditions, such as in industrial buildings or outdoor elevators. EPDM U shaped rubber strips are also commonly used. EPDM has good resistance to ozone, UV rays, and water, which is ideal for elevators in all kinds of settings.

Now, I know you might be wondering about the installation process. Installing U shaped rubber strips in an elevator is relatively straightforward. In most cases, they can be simply snapped or glued into place. However, it's important to make sure that the strips are properly sized and installed correctly to ensure optimal performance.
